
One night Steve and I decided to revisit Gremlins. I remember loving it while simultaneously being terrified of it. My entire adult life I've believed that I was just kind of a candy ass, fraidy cat kinda kid. My only memory of the actual movie was a lit up fountain that was absolutely terrifying. I saw Gremlins as a very small child, and I directly remember being huddled in a sleeping bag next to my cousin who was similarly huddled. We may have been whimpering. God knows where our mothers were because that movie is seriously THE SCARIEST MOVIE I HAVE EVER SEEN IN MY ENTIRE LIFE.

Oh my sweet Lord, I was still huddled in a ball, twenty years later, watching it with the lights on. I kept yelling "Pick the sword you ass clown" and "Damn it, Corey Feldman, you've ruined everything!"
Afterwards I got out to my car and, I am ashamed to say, I checked my back seat. Twice.
Don't get me wrong, Gizmo is mighty cute (strangely enough he is voiced by Howie Mandel), but that movie is really dark.

The whole time I was squealing about how cute Gizmo was I couldn't help but think of the green, apparently gelatinous Gremlins being oh say chopped up in a food processor.
